In affected versions the shape inference code for `QuantizeV","summary":"TensorFlow, an open-source machine learning platform, has a vulnerability in its shape inference code for the `QuantizeV2` function that allows reading memory outside of the intended boundaries (heap OOB read, or out-of-bounds read) when the `axis` parameter is given a negative value less than -1. This happens because the code doesn't properly validate that negative axis values stay within acceptable bounds before accessing memory.","solution":"The fix will be included in TensorFlow 2.7.0. The fix will also be applied to TensorFlow 2.6.1, as this is the only other version affected.","labels":["security"],"sourceUrl":"https://nvd.nist.gov/vuln/detail/CVE-2021-41211","publishedAt":"2021-11-06T01:15:08.813Z","cveId":"CVE-2021-41211","cweIds":["CWE-125","CWE-125"],"cvssScore":"7.1","cvssSeverity":"high","severity":"high","attackType":["other"],"issueType":"vulnerability","affectedPackages":null,"affectedVendors":["NVIDIA"],"affectedVendorsRaw":["TensorFlow"],"classifierModel":"claude-haiku-4-5-20251001","classifierPromptVersion":"v3","cvssVector":null,"attackVector":null,"attackComplexity":null,"privilegesRequired":null,"userInteraction":null,"exploitMaturity":"unknown","epssScore":0.00019,"patchAvailable":null,"disclosureDate":null,"capecIds":["CAPEC-540"],"crossRefCount":0,"attackSophistication":"moderate","impactType":["confidentiality","integrity","availability"],"aiComponentTargeted":"framework","llmSpecific":false,"classifierConfidence":0.92,"researchCategory":null,"atlasIds":null}}
